Shares of Asset Reconstruction Company (India) Ltd, better known as Arcil, saw a flat market debut on Thursday, listing at par with the issue price of Rs 139.
The stock listed at Rs 139 on both the BSE and NSE. The shares later climbed 1.87 per cent to Rs 141.60 on the BSE.
The company's market valuation was Rs 4,421.85 crore.
The Rs 733-crore initial share sale of Asset Reconstruction Company (India) Ltd was subscribed 20.10 times on Friday last week.
Arcil fixed a price band of Rs 132-139 per share for its IPO, which was entirely an offer for sale (OFS). Since there was no fresh issue, Arcil did not receive any proceeds from the offering.
Asset Reconstruction Company (India) Ltd had garnered Rs 220 crore from anchor investors.
Arcil operates as an asset reconstruction company and is engaged in acquiring stressed assets from banks and financial institutions and implementing resolution strategies through restructuring, enforcement of rights over underlying securities and settlement.
